bool rpcentry::initialize(const char *rpcname, int number) {
#if defined(RUDIMENTS_HAVE_GETRPCBYNAME_R) && \
defined(RUDIMENTS_HAVE_GETRPCBYNUMBER_R)
if (pvt->_re) {
pvt->_re=NULL;
delete[] pvt->_buffer;
pvt->_buffer=NULL;
}
// getrpcbyname_r is goofy.
// It will retrieve an arbitrarily large amount of data, but
// requires that you pass it a pre-allocated buffer. If the
// buffer is too small, it returns an ENOMEM and you have to
// just make the buffer bigger and try again.
for (int size=1024; size<MAXBUFFER; size=size+1024) {
pvt->_buffer=new char[size];
#if defined(RUDIMENTS_HAVE_GETRPCBYNAME_R_5) && \
defined(RUDIMENTS_HAVE_GETRPCBYNUMBER_R_5)
if (!((rpcname)
?(getrpcbyname_r(rpcname,&pvt->_rebuffer,
pvt->_buffer,size,
&pvt->_re))
:(getrpcbynumber_r(number,&pvt->_rebuffer,
pvt->_buffer,size,
&pvt->_re)))) {
return (pvt->_re!=NULL);
}
#elif defined(RUDIMENTS_HAVE_GETRPCBYNAME_R_4) && \
defined(RUDIMENTS_HAVE_GETRPCBYNUMBER_R_4)
if ((rpcname)
?(pvt->_re=getrpcbyname_r(rpcname,
&pvt->_rebuffer,
pvt->_buffer,size))
:(pvt->_re=getrpcbynumber_r(number,
&pvt->_rebuffer,
pvt->_buffer,size))) {
return true;
}
#endif
delete[] pvt->_buffer;
pvt->_buffer=NULL;
pvt->_re=NULL;
if (error::getErrorNumber()!=ENOMEM) {
return false;
}
}
return false;
#else
pvt->_re=NULL;
return (!(remutex && !remutex->lock()) &&
((pvt->_re=((rpcname)
?getrpcbyname(const_cast<char *>(rpcname))
:getrpcbynumber(number)))!=NULL) &&
!(remutex && !remutex->unlock()));
#endif
}
